Cofactor |
COFACTOR: Name=[4Fe-4S] cluster; Xref=ChEBI:CHEBI:49883; Evidence={ECO:0000255|HAMAP-Rule:MF_03183}; Note=Binds 1 [4Fe-4S] cluster. The cluster does not appear to play a role in catalysis, but is probably involved in the proper positioning of the enzyme along the DNA strand. {ECO:0000255|HAMAP-Rule:MF_03183}; |
